
A flower of brinjal plant following the process of sexual reproduction produces 360 viable seeds. Answer the following questions giving reasons.
(a) How many ovules are minimally involved?
(b) How many megaspore mother cells are involved?
(c) What is the minimum number of pollen grains that must land on stigma for pollination?
(d) How many male gametes are involved in the above case?
(e) How many microspore mother cells must have undergone reduction division prior to dehiscence of anther in the above case?

Hint: In process of sexual reproduction, a complex life cycle is involved in which a single set of chromosomes (haploid) combines a gamete (such as a sperm or egg cell) with another to create an entity composed of cells with two sets of chromosomes (diploid).
Complete answer:
The no. of viable seeds produced by the brinjal plant through sexual reproduction as stated in question = 360
(a) Fruit is formed from mature ovary. The ovary grows into a fruit after fertilization and the ovules develop into seeds. If the number of viable seeds is 360, the number of ovules minimally involved in this process will be 360. The number of ovules is then equal to the number of seeds that have been produced.
(b) 360 megaspore mother cells are active during the gametogenesis process when only one megaspore of the tetrad remains functional and grows more and the other three megaspores degenerate.
(c) The minimum number of pollen grains to land under the pollination stigma is 360 and there are two male gametes in each pollen grain. One fuses with polar nuclei and forms endosperm from these two gametes, while the other male gamete fuses with the egg cell to create the zygote that finally gives birth to the seeds. Therefore the amount of pollen grains required will be 360 to obtain 360 seeds.
(d) When each male gamete fuses with one egg nucleus to form zygote, the number of male gametes involved in seed forming will be 360, which would further give birth to the seed.
(e) In the above example, prior to the dehiscence of anther, 90 microspore mother cells (360/4) would have undergone reduction division, as each microspore mother cell will give birth to 4 microspores. Therefore to acquire 360 microspores, there must be 90 microspore mother cells, since 1 microspore mother cell would contain 4 microspores.
Note: Within the flower and the seeds that are inside a fruit, these sex organs in plants are carried. Angiosperms or flowering plants are called such plants as they reproduce by the method of sexual reproduction. Most plants produce both male and female reproductive organs in the flowers.
